Yeah I cant see any problems with adding a few rams into your setup. With that size of tank you could easily have about 4-6 rams and hopefully a few would even pair up.

Paul.
 
My Blue Rams get on fine with everything apart from Gouramis. They should be fine with everything you currently have, but you need to remember that Blue Rams are fairly fussy about water conditions.
